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
131549 6261 44599122711
65817414257 270
65817414257 270
4183 9106 4649760293 48027
All about undefined
Interested in learning more?
65817414257 270
4183 9106 4649760293 48027
See more
23 135025
669 24 42437938
See more
08313 373 638925421
749244 31841833782 4052421
See more